Qatar Airways announced the launch of 11 weekly flights to the Greek capital, Athens, and the carrier said: “The company’s customers can travel on business-class Quesuit seats to 30 global destinations, including London, Paris and Frankfurt, noting that these seats provide great privacy thanks to its wide area. And the separations between the seats.

 

Qatar Airways announced the increase in the number of flights to Rome and Milan to 11 flights per week to Rome and 10 flights per week to Milan, and Qatar Airways said: Thanks to providing us with the greatest possible flexibility, passengers can change the reservation of their original destination to any other city within the same country or any destination Others as long as it is less than 5000 miles from the original destination. Qatar Airways said: “Travel with us to the most beautiful places in the world aboard our Airbus A350 aircraft, which features a spacious and quiet cabin.
